How Our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Process Works
When you call our team, we’ll send a certified IICRC technician to assess the damage and create a personalized plan to restore your bathroom to its original state. Our process is designed to be as efficient and stress-free as possible, with clear communication every step of the way. Our team will work tirelessly to reduce downtime and get you back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 1: Emergency Response
Our team arrives within 60 minutes of your call and assesses the damage. We’ll identify the source of the water, find out the extent of the damage, and create a plan to restore your bathroom. Our technicians are equipped to handle even the most severe water damage situations.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from your bathroom, reducing further damage. Our team will also identify and address any safety hazards, such as unstable flooring or structural damage. Our equipment is designed to handle the toughest extraction jobs.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your bathroom, preventing further damage and growth of mold and mildew. Our technicians are trained to identify and address any potential issues early on.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
We’ll use specialized equipment to sanitize and disinfect your bathroom, removing any b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ants. Our team takes pride in leaving your bathroom clean and safe.
Step 5: Reconstruction and Restoration
Once your bathroom has been dried and sanitized, our team will begin the reconstruction and restoration process, restoring your bathroom to its original state. We use only the highest-quality materials to ensure a durable and long-lasting finish.

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Damage Restoration
Catching signs of water damage early can save you time, money, and stress.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ell in your bathroom, it may be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it – call our team to assess the issue and prevent further damage.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on your bathroom walls or ceiling can be a sign of water damage. Address it quickly to prevent further issues.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
If your bathroom flooring is warped or buckled, it may be a sign of water damage. Call our team to assess and repair the damage before it gets worse.
Water Damage on Your Walls or Ceiling
Water damage on your bathroom walls or ceiling can be a sign of a bigger issue. Don’t delay – call our team to assess and repair the damage.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water damage is minor and contained | Yes | No | You can handle minor water damage with DIY methods, such as using a wet vacuum and drying the area. |
| Water damage is extensive and affects multiple areas | No | Yes | Extensive water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| You’re not sure what to do or how to handle the situation | No | Yes | Water damage can be complex and confusing – call a professional to ensure the issue is handled correctly and safely. |
| You don’t have the necessary equipment or expertise | No | Yes | Water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ively. |
| You’re unsure about insurance coverage or the cost of repairs | No | Yes | Call a professional to assess the damage and find out the best course of action for your specific situation. |
| Water damage is suspected but not confirmed | No | Yes | Call a professional to assess the situation and find out the best course of action. |

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in St. David, AZ
The cost of bathroom water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in St. David, AZ. Our team will provide you with a personalized estimate based on your specific situation. We’re transparent about our pricing and will work with you to find a solution that fits your bud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$200 – $1,200 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Sanitizing and disinfecting |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Reconstruction and rest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| More services (e.g. Mold remediation, structural repair) |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
